Quick note for plugin folks: Pebblecache sits in front of our Quartzstore KV as a bloom filter, so expect occasional false positives on membership checks — always confirm with a real GET. Rebuilds happen nightly, and hit rates dip for a few minutes after. To test your plugin against the staging filter endpoint, authenticate with the key below.

app token of yajeg-kawef = kto11_7En3XSX8xQw

Runbook: GarageGlance occupancy feed

If the Harborview Deck occupancy feed goes stale (no updates for 5+ minutes), first check the sensor gateway health page. Green but stale usually means the aggregator queue is backed up; restart the aggregator via the ops console and counts should recover within two minutes. If spots show negative numbers, force a full recount from the camera snapshots. When escalating to engineering, include the trace token shown below.

session token of yawif-kahof = htk9_dd6996ed6

### Step 7: Migrate plugin job records to the Renderhive v3 catalog

Plugins that queued transcode jobs against the v2 farm must repoint their job catalog reads to the new Renderhive catalog database. Before switching, drain any in-flight jobs your plugin owns, since job IDs are not preserved across catalogs. Then update your plugin manifest's datasource block and run the verification script to confirm read access. Your manifest should reference the following connection string.

warehouse DSN: mssql://druius_svc:aJ@db-b2f3.xolmarhq.local:5432/soreth

## Soft deletes in `orders`

We never hard-delete from the `orders` table in Brindlework. Rows get a `deleted_at` timestamp instead; all queries must filter on it. The nightly Cobbler job archives rows older than 18 months to cold storage. If you add a new query path, include the soft-delete predicate or the linter will block your merge. Full rationale, schema history, and the archival schedule are documented on the team wiki page.

runbook for badug-kadup: https://confluence.zemvarlabs.internal/projects/browse/display/projects/bd1b